Work begins in York to build "Britain’s oldest house"

Naj Modak meets people involved in the building of a replica 11,000-year-old home. A team from the York Museums Trust and the University of York, and experts in ancient technology and archaeology, are building the Mesolithic house in York Museum Gardens. Evidence from the world famous prehistoric archaeological site Star Carr in Yorkshire is being used to build this home.
